In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ding PR4 1SD,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 52.6%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.
In the immediate vicinity of PR4 1SD there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 52.4%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.
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Clitheroes Lane was 17.8 per 1,000 residents, which is 69.7% lower than the Freckleton Village average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
Clitheroes Lane has the 4th lowest crime rate of 48 local areas in Freckleton Village and the 30th lowest crime rate of 272 local areas in Fylde .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 10.2 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 44.4%.
